The denial letter wasn't very informational regarding why I was denied, but I called HP yesterday and found out it was because the pulmonologist said my sleep apnea is under control with conventional medical treatment.
I think it's a misunderstanding in that the pulmonary specialist meant it was under control enough to undergo surgery (which apparently is also what HP thinks but the report he sent them was just too ambiguous on that point for them to make a determination).
HP has actually been very helpful. They told me what I need to do in order to get approved for the surgery. I guess I wasn't expecting that from them. Anyway, I need to get a better report from the pulmonary specialist I saw or see a different one to get a specific opinion on how the sleep apnea is affecting my daily life. Once I get that, I can resubmit and they'll reconsider. Since the HP people said that was the only reason it was denied, if I get a report like that, it will be approved.
